Who attends Elevate?

At Elevate's large events, single adults of all ages attend. At our 2.0 events, the main audience is single adults in their 20s; at our 3.0 events, it's single adults in their 30s; and at our 4.0 events, it's single adults over the age of 40. Participants in this ministry come from a variety of backgrounds. Some have never been married, and some are divorced or widowed.

Why does Elevate encourage community groups?

Large group functions are great to meet new people and build friendships in a fun and safe atmosphere. But we believe that many things that are vital to personal spiritual growth cannot be accomplished in a large group. Openness, accountability, deeper relationship building and deeper spiritual questioning are things that often occur more easily in a smaller group.
